The NFL drives the betting calendar

Football betting in Ontario means the NFL above all — a weekly rhythm of Thursday, Sunday and Monday games from September through the playoffs, building to the Super Bowl, the single most-bet event of the year. Because each team plays roughly once a week, lines open early and move all week, giving bettors time to shop the markets.

The markets you'll see

  • Point spread — the dominant NFL market, handicapping favourite vs. underdog.
  • Totals (over/under) — the combined points, usually in the 40s.
  • Moneyline — a straight pick of the winner.
  • Player props — passing, rushing and receiving yards, touchdowns and more.
  • Same-game parlays — stacking markets from one game into a single ticket.
  • Futures — Super Bowl, conference, division and MVP odds, plus live betting drive by drive.

Betting on football legally in Ontario

Only iGaming Ontario–registered, AGCO-regulated operators may legally take football bets from Ontario residents. Every book we cover is on that registry.
